I really liked Ocho Rios! And, we never felt unsafe for even a minute.
But, I think the key is this: We had a wonderful guide... privately booked. He sheparded just five of us around, and I guess he really knew what he was doing. We went to the falls, to fern gully, and then to a beach, where three of the five of us got a private snorkel on a boat he booked for us!
We were never bothered by a single vendor.
O'Neal (our guide) was yound, energetic, very entertaining, and extremely knowledgeable. We learned a LOT while having a wonderful time!
